💻
ChatGPT intermediate

Como testar casos de uso práticos em full stack em Full Stack

Prompt gerado automaticamente para Casos de uso práticos em Full Stack em Full Stack

2 usos Full Stack

Prompt completo

Você é um especialista em arquitetura de software e desenvolvimento Full Stack. Crie um caso de uso prático para uma aplicação web que resolva o problema comum de **sincronização e visualização de dados em tempo real provenientes de múltiplas fontes heterogêneas**, como APIs REST, WebSockets e bancos de dados SQL/NoSQL, em um dashboard interativo para usuários finais.

Descreva:

1.  **O problema atual:** Detalhe os desafios de performance, latência e complexidade de integração que surgem ao tentar consolidar e apresentar esses dados de forma coesa.
2.  **A solução proposta (com foco Full Stack):**
    *   **Frontend:** Que tecnologias (frameworks, bibliotecas, padrões de arquitetura) seriam utilizadas para garantir uma UI responsiva, reatividade e boa experiência do usuário ao lidar com atualizações constantes? Como gerenciar o estado da aplicação e a comunicação em tempo real?
    *   **Backend:** Que tecnologias e padrões de arquitetura (microsserviços, *event-driven*, *message queues*) seriam empregados para orquestrar a coleta, transformação e agregação dos dados das diferentes fontes? Como lidar com a escalabilidade, resiliência e segurança?
    *   **Banco de Dados/Armazenamento:** Que tipos de bancos de dados seriam mais adequados para persistir e consultar esses dados em tempo real e históricos? (Ex: séries temporais, documentos, relacionais).
    *   **Comunicação em Tempo Real:** Como seria implementada a comunicação bidirecional entre frontend e backend para as atualizações em tempo real (ex: WebSockets, Server-Sent Events, gRPC)?
    *   **Orquestração/Deployment:** Breve menção a como essa aplicação seria empacotada e orquestrada (Docker, Kubernetes) para garantir alta disponibilidade e escalabilidade.
3.  **Benefícios claros:** Quais as vantagens da sua solução em termos de eficiência, usabilidade e manutenção?
4.  **Métricas de sucesso:** Como você mediria o sucesso da implementação desta solução?

O tom deve ser técnico, mas acessível, e focado em soluções práticas e arquiteturas modernas.

Tags relacionadas

Full Stack Casos de uso práticos em Full Stack gerado-automaticamente

Como usar este prompt

1

Clique no botão "Copiar" para copiar o prompt para sua área de transferência

2

Acesse sua ferramenta de IA preferida (ChatGPT, ChatGPT, Claude, etc.)

3

Cole o prompt e adapte conforme necessário para seu contexto específico